đź’»

Full-Stack Engineer

Skills & Experience

  • Job titles: Full Stack
  • Experience level: Mid, Senior
  • Tech stack used: React, Typescript, JavaScript, Python, PostgreSQL
  • Primary skills we consider: Typescript, JavaScript, React, Python, AWS
  • Secondary skills we consider: Artificial Intelligence, Machine Learning

Logistics

  • Employment type: Permanent
  • Remote working: On-site, Hybrid, Remote
  • Remote locations: Anywhere
  • Working Timezones: (UTC) London +/- 5 hours
  • Visa sponsorship: Available

Role

Frontdoor is looking for a Full Stack Engineer to join our team and help build our social discovery engine. Our work is at the forefront of next-generation networks (web3), leveraging techniques from AI (large language models)

We're well-funded by some of the best VCs in our space and are moving at breakneck speed. If that excites you - we're always looking for amazing talent to join us and help shape the future of discovery!

Responsibilities:

  • Develop and maintain the Frontdoor web app and chrome extension using React
  • Write clean, efficient, and well-documented code using Python
  • Work with the team to design and implement new features
  • Collaborate with other engineers and stakeholders to improve the overall platform
  • Use your expertise in AI and OpenAI to develop and integrate the backend AI functionalities
  • Troubleshoot and debug issues as they arise

Requirements:

  • Exceptional experience with React and strong experience with Python
  • Good experience with SQL and familiarity with PostgreSQL
  • Knowledge of AI, OpenAI APIs, and vector databases (e.g. Pinecone)
  • Experience with BERT or other language models is a plus
  • Experience with recommender systems is a plus
  • Strong problem-solving skills and the ability to work well in a fast-moving team environment

Interview Process

We’re looking for a hungry, ambitious full-stack engineer keen to get their hands dirty and take projects from 0 to 1 and beyond. We care about what you’ve shipped - we’re looking for great, scrappy builders who get things done.

We don't believe in lengthy interview processes. We move fast, and our typical process includes a call with the founders along with a short technical challenge to showcase how you think.

Benefits 🌴

  • 💰 Competitive salary + equity package
  • 💻 Laptop of your choice + stipend for your setup
  • 📧 Subscription to Superhuman, Arc Browser, Cron, etc.
  • 🏖 Unlimited vacation (we really mean it!)